Private Diagnosis of ADHD: Understanding the Process, Benefits, and FAQs
Attention Deficit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ental condition that affects both kids and adults. Its signs-- such as in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ity-- can substantially impact everyday life and general well-being. Generally identified through public health care systems, more people are turning to private diagnosis services to look for quicker assessments and customized treatment options. This short article explores the procedure of getting a private diagnosis for ADHD, its benefits, prospective concerns, and regularly asked questions.
Comprehending ADHD and the Need for Diagnosis
ADHD is identified by a consistent pattern of negligence and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that hinders functioning or development. Although the precise causes stay uncertain, genetics, environment, and brain structure are believed to play a function.
Significance of Diagnosis
A formal diagnosis of ADHD can pave the way for effective management and support techniques. It is vital for:
Accessing treatment choices (medication, therapy, etc)Understanding individual difficultiesEnhancing coping methods in instructional or occupational settingsThe Process of Private Diagnosis for ADHDStep 1: Initial Consultation
The journey normally starts with a preliminary consultation with a certified healthcare expert, such as a psychiatrist or psychologist. This conference intends to go over signs, case history, and any previous assessments.
Action 2: Comprehensive Assessment
During the assessment phase, practitioners will perform:
Clinical interviews: Discussing history and behaviourStandardized ranking scales: Utilized to examine symptom seriousnessObservational assessments: Noting behaviour in different settingsStep 3: Feedback Session
After the assessments are completed, a feedback session is arranged. Here, the doctor will talk about the results, provide the diagnosis (if suitable), and recommend management techniques.
Step 4: Follow-Up Care
Post-diagnosis, individuals can take advantage of follow-up consultations to keep track of progress and make any required modifications to treatment.

Just how much does a private ADHD diagnosis cost?
The cost for a private diagnosis of adhd ADHD diagnosis can differ commonly, varying from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 depending on the degree of the assessments, location, and particular services supplied.
2. For how long does the assessment take?
The assessment generally lasts from one to 3 hours, depending on the person's requirements and the particular tests administered. Follow-up sessions might likewise be needed.
3. Is a private diagnosis valid?
Yes, a legitimate diagnosis from a licensed expert is acknowledged by healthcare systems and universities. Last but not least, it's essential to ensure the practitioner is accredited and follows standardized assessment procedures.
4. Can I get treatment from the very same service provider?
A lot of private diagnosis clinics likewise provide treatment services, consisting of medication management, treatment, and support system. It's recommended to ask throughout the preliminary assessment.
